Warning Signs You Need Restaurant Water Damage Restoration
Water damage in your restaurant can be a serious issue, but it’s often easy to spot the warning signs. Here are a few things to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ty smell in your restaurant, it’s likely a sign of water damage. This can be caused by moisture in the walls or floors, or even a leaky pipe. You need to address this iss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ings are clear signs of water damage. This can be caused by a leaky roof, burst pipe, or even a clogged drain.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ring is a sign of water damage, especially if it’s accompanied by a musty smell. You need to address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and ensure the safety of your customers.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per is a sign of water damage, especially if it’s accompanied by a musty smell. You need to address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and ensure the safety of your customers.
Unusual Odors or Sounds
Unusual odors or sounds coming from your restaurant’s pipes or plumbing system can be a sign of water damage. You need to address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and ensure the safety of your customers.

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ration Cost in Argyle, TX
The cost of restaurant water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Argyle,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| The cost of water extraction and drying depends on the amount of water involved and the size of the affected area. |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$500 – $2,000 | The cost of cleaning and disinfection depends on the extent of the damage and the types of surfaces affected. |
| Reconstruction and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| The cost of reconstruction and repair dep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to restore the affected area. |
| Final Inspection and Sanitization | $200 – $1,000 | The cost of final inspection and sanitization depends on the number of areas affected and the types of surfaces involved. |

How Do I Prevent Future Water Damage in My Restaurant?
To prevent future water damage in your restaurant, it’s essential to regularly inspect your plumbing system, check for leaks, and ensure that your water heater is properly maintained. You should also consider installing a water sensor or monitoring system to detect potential issues before they become major problems.
